Output 17895aedc2829129bfbc98ddb632f999a5b501b532735b7d5f854b0e8a2ff85a:0

value
1811355
script pubkey
OP_0 OP_PUSHBYTES_20 19dda42be93b18324d0a188099715a375dc99b1f
address
bc1qr8w6g2lf8vvryng2rzqfju26xawunxcl6px8vp
transaction
17895aedc2829129bfbc98ddb632f999a5b501b532735b7d5f854b0e8a2ff85a
spent
true